Kibbeh with Yogurt
Kibbeh with yogurt is one of the tastiest dishes in Arab cuisine, served hot or cold! Some people also add shish barak to it. A super delicious recipe—give it a try!

Ingredients
- 1 kilo yogurt
- 1 cup water
- 1 tablespoon cornstarch
- Prepared kibbeh patties... here is how to make them from Rana fried kibbeh
- crushed garlic
- fresh coriander
- salt
- fried nuts in ghee or butter - optional

Method
- Strain the yogurt and put it in a pot with the water and starch, stirring well while cold.
- Place the pot over the heat and stir constantly so the yogurt doesn't curdle... cook over medium heat.
- Fry the kibbeh until half‑cooked.
- When the yogurt boils, add the kibbeh patties after draining them well from the oil.
- Let the yogurt boil again over low heat until the kibbeh is fully cooked.
- Sauté the garlic and coriander briefly and add them to the yogurt, adjust the salt, and let them simmer for two minutes.
- Add the fried nuts and a sprinkle of fresh coriander, then turn off the heat.
